Common Pain Points for Brownsville Providers

These problems are common across South Texas med spas and clinics.

Medspas and IV clinics cannot operate legally without physician oversight

Texas requires physician supervision for medical and aesthetic services. Opening without a Medical Director risks delays, billing issues, and potential board complaints.

NPs and PAs need written collaboration or prescriptive authority agreements

Advanced practice providers must have formal agreements that define scope, chart review cadence, and prescriptive authority. Missing terms can halt prescribing and patient care.

Many clinics risk fines or license action due to poor delegation practices

Gaps in standing orders, documentation, or chart review frequency can trigger corrective action. Written protocols and consistent oversight keep your team protected.

Texas Oversight Compliance Rules

Collaborative Practice for Nurse Practitioners

In Texas, Nurse Practitioners (Advanced Practice Registered Nurses) must operate under a delegation agreement with a supervising physician. This written document defines prescriptive authority, chart review procedures, and communication standards. Texas law does not allow independent practice for NPs.

Prescriptive Authority

Physicians may delegate limited prescriptive authority to APRNs or PAs via a Prescriptive Authority Agreement (PAA). The agreement must include physician oversight, periodic chart review, and communication requirements. A physician may delegate to up to seven advanced practice providers at a time.

Supervision of Physician Assistants

PAs must also have a written supervision agreement defining the scope of practice and prescriptive authority. Remote supervision is permitted if accessible communication and oversight are maintained.

Delegation Protocols (Aesthetic & Medical Procedures)

Only physicians can diagnose, prescribe, and delegate medical acts. Non-physicians (RNs, PAs, estheticians) may perform delegated medical tasks only under a standing delegation order or protocol compliant with the Texas Medical Practice Act.

Malpractice Insurance

Physicians serving as medical directors must maintain active malpractice coverage that includes delegated services. Clinics are responsible for verifying coverage before launching operations.
